LJ FB: More all-league honors

By Ed Piper

"An embarrassment of riches."

With the success of the La Jolla High football team in 2019, including the program's first league title since 1995, first CIF championship since 1993, and first-ever Southern California title (Division 4A), Head Coach Tyler Roach's players garnered a cornucopia of All-Eastern League honors in addition to junior Max Smith's All-CIF First Team award.

On offense, being named First Team All-Eastern League were junior playmaker Diego Solis and sophomore quarterback Jackson Stratton. Makai Smith, a sophomore who caught and ran the ball from scrimmage and also returned kicks, was named to the Second Team in his initial year at La Jolla High.

Kicker/punter Devin Bale, a junior, was named to the First Team on special teams.

From coordinator Charles Bussey's defense, named First Team All-Eastern League were the three lead linebackers, Max Smith, senior Jack Wiese, and junior Dirk Germon, as well as senior cornerback Calvin Hyytinen. Max Smith was also named the league's Player of the Year for his offensive and defensive contributions. (See separate blog entry.)

To the Second Team on defense were named junior linebacker Grady Mitchell, junior Luke Brunette, senior safety Finn Rice, and senior linebacker L.T. Shimp.
